■ F1-08/F1-09: Overspeed Detection Level / Delay Time
F1-08 sets the detection level for an overspeed (oS) fault as a percentage of the maximum
output frequency. The speed feedback has to exceed this level for longer than the time set in
F1-09 before a fault is detected.
■ F1-10/F1-11: Excessive Speed Deviation Detection Level / Delay Time
F1-10 sets the detection level for a speed deviation (dEv) fault as a percentage of the
maximum output frequency. The speed feedback has to exceed this level for longer than the
time set in F1-11 before a fault is detected. Speed deviation is the difference between actual
motor speed and the frequency reference command.
■ F1-14: PG Open-Circuit Detection Time
Sets the time required to detect PGo if no pulse signal is present at terminal RP.

No. Parameter Name Setting Range Default
F1-08 Overspeed Detection Level 0 to 120% 115%
F1-09 Overspeed Detection Delay Time 0.0 to 2.0 s 1.0 s
No. Parameter Name Setting Range Default
F1-10 Excessive Speed Deviation Detection Level 0 to 50% 10%
F1-11 Excessive Speed Deviation Detection Delay Time 0.0 to 10.0 s 0.5 s
No. Parameter Name Setting Range Default
F1-14 PG Open-Circuit Detection Time 0.0 to 10.0 s 2.0 s
